Whitehall baseball drops doubleheader to Sparta

Whitehall lost a doubleheader to Sparta Friday, 4-1 and 9-6, as the Vikings continued to tune up for the postseason.
The first game went to extra innings with the score tied at 1. Each team's only run in regulation came in the third inning; Justin Jensen tied it up with a RBI double to score Cody Manzo after he singled.
In the eighth, Sparta took advantage of an error and scored the go-ahead run, then added two more after the Vikings walked a batter and hit another.
Emmett Hecht got two hits for Whitehall in the opener, and Noah Peterson pitched six innings of no-hit baseball, striking out five and walking five.
Whitehall was in position to win the nightcap before Sparta scored five times in the sixth inning to take the lead for good. Five Vikings got a hit each in game two; Noah Peterson and Manzo each drew a walk in addition to their one hit, and James Brooks walked twice. Hecht pitched a scoreless inning of relief, striking out one.
